From the very beginning we have been committed to organic and sustainable production and to the use of biodynamic agriculture in our commercial activities. The biodynamic method originated at the start of the 20th century with Rudolf Steiner. It aims to rescue ancestral cultivation practices, with the goal of recovering soil fertility, and allowing animals and plants to coexist in symbiosis, with minimum human intervention. At Finca la Torre we have been certified according to the EC directive on organic agriculture since 2001, and we have had the Demeter certification for biodynamic agriculture since 2006. (

One of the fundamental pillars of biodynamic agriculture is the use of compost to boost the soil’s microbial activity. At Finca la Torre, we make this compost from crushed olive pulp produced in our olive mill, and from manure originating from nearby livestock farms.
Finally, the use of biodynamic preparations – such as one based on cow horn – and a specific calendar that recommends the ideal moment to carry out different agricultural tasks complement the usual practices for this type of agriculture.
